Transaction 3734fc32f51580961857eb17d81f014383ff0bb1c9ce58ae7777fb36056ee637
3 Input
2 Outputs
- 3734fc32f51580961857eb17d81f014383ff0bb1c9ce58ae7777fb36056ee637:0
- 3734fc32f51580961857eb17d81f014383ff0bb1c9ce58ae7777fb36056ee637:1
value 3000000000
address 35ETHGPUDt7EHL1y3t6jwTQzSVTSA8J3Mh
value 1195600000
address 3BMEXuS9JDmkm8EwsS6iK3hscUFwj9u5V8